所选语种没有对应资源,请选择:

本站点使用Cookies,继续浏览表示您同意我们使用Cookies。Cookies和隐私政策>

提示

尊敬的用户,您的IE浏览器版本过低,为获取更好的浏览体验,请升级您的IE浏览器。

升级

S1720, S2700, S5700, S6720 V200R010C00 配置指南-IP单播路由

本文档介绍了设备支持的IP单播路由相关配置。主要内容包括IP路由概述,静态路由、RIP、RIPng、OSPF、OSPFv3、IS-IS(IPv4)、IS-IS(IPv6)、BGP、路由策略以及策略路由的基本原理和配置过程,并提供相关的配置案例。
评分并提供意见反馈 :
华为采用机器翻译与人工审校相结合的方式将此文档翻译成不同语言,希望能帮助您更容易理解此文档的内容。 请注意:即使是最好的机器翻译,其准确度也不及专业翻译人员的水平。 华为对于翻译的准确性不承担任何责任,并建议您参考英文文档(已提供链接)。
配置IPv6静态路由与静态BFD联动示例

配置IPv6静态路由与静态BFD联动示例

组网需求

图1所示,SwitchA和SwitchB相连。在SwitchA和SwitchB间配置了IPv6静态路由。客户希望在SwitchA和SwitchB之间的链路进行毫秒级故障检测,并及时刷新IPv6路由表。

图3-9  配置IPv6静态路由与静态BFD联动组网图

配置思路

用户可以考虑配置IPv6静态路由与静态BFD联动来实现以上需求。采用如下思路配置IPv6静态路由与静态BFD联动:

  1. 在SwitchA和SwitchB上配置BFD会话,实现SwitchA和SwitchB之间的链路的毫秒级检测。

  2. 配置SwitchA到SwitchB的IPv6静态路由并绑定BFD会话,实现在检测出故障后及时刷新IPv6路由表。

操作步骤

  1. 配置各Switch接口IPv6地址

    # 配置SwitchA。SwitchB的配置与SwitchA类似。

    <HUAWEI> system-view
    [HUAWEI] sysname SwitchA
    [SwitchA] ipv6
    [SwitchA] interface GigabitEthernet 0/0/1
    [SwitchA-GigabitEthernet0/0/1] undo portswitch
    [SwitchA-GigabitEthernet0/0/1] ipv6 enable
    [SwitchA-GigabitEthernet0/0/1] ipv6 address fc00::1 64
    [SwitchA-GigabitEthernet0/0/1] quit
    

  2. 配置SwitchA和SwitchB之间的BFD会话

    # 在SwitchA上配置与SwitchB之间的BFD会话。

    [SwitchA] bfd
    [SwitchA-bfd] quit
    [SwitchA] bfd aa bind peer-ipv6 fc00::2
    [SwitchA-bfd-session-aa] discriminator local 10
    [SwitchA-bfd-session-aa] discriminator remote 20
    [SwitchA-bfd-session-aa] commit
    [SwitchA-bfd-session-aa] quit

    # 在SwitchB上配置与SwitchA之间的BFD会话。

    [SwitchB] bfd
    [SwitchB-bfd] quit
    [SwitchB] bfd bb bind peer-ipv6 fc00::1
    [SwitchB-bfd-session-bb] discriminator local 20
    [SwitchB-bfd-session-bb] discriminator remote 10
    [SwitchB-bfd-session-bb] commit
    [SwitchB-bfd-session-bb] quit

  3. 配置静态缺省路由并绑定BFD会话

    # 在SwitchA上配置到SwitchB的静态缺省路由,并绑定BFD会话aa。

    [SwitchA] ipv6 route-static 0::0 0 fc00::2 track bfd-session aa

  4. 验证配置结果

    # 配置完成后,在SwitchA和SwitchB上执行display bfd session all命令,可以看到BFD会话已经建立,且状态为Up。以SwitchA上的显示为例。

    [SwitchA] display bfd session all
    --------------------------------------------------------------------------------
    Local Remote     PeerIpAddr      State     Type         InterfaceName           
    --------------------------------------------------------------------------------
    10    20         FC00::2                                                        
                                     Up        S_IP_PEER          -                 
    --------------------------------------------------------------------------------
         Total UP/DOWN Session Number : 1/0                                         

    # 在SwitchA和SwitchB上执行display current-configuration | include bfd命令,可以看到静态路由已经绑定BFD会话。以SwitchA上的显示为例。

    [SwitchA] display current-configuration | include bfd
    bfd                                                                             
    bfd aa bind peer-ipv6 FC00::2                                                   
    ipv6 route-static :: 0 FC00::2 track bfd-session aa

    # 在SwitchA上查看IPv6路由表,缺省静态路由存在于路由表中。

    [SwitchA] display ipv6 routing-table
    Routing Table : Public                                                          
            Destinations : 5        Routes : 5                                      
                                                                                    
     Destination  : ::                              PrefixLength : 0                
     NextHop      : FC00::2                         Preference   : 60               
     Cost         : 0                               Protocol     : Static           
     RelayNextHop : ::                              TunnelID     : 0x0              
     Interface    : GigabitEthernet0/0/1            Flags        : RD               
                                                                                    
     Destination  : ::1                             PrefixLength : 128              
     NextHop      : ::1                             Preference   : 0                
     Cost         : 0                               Protocol     : Direct           
     RelayNextHop : ::                              TunnelID     : 0x0              
     Interface    : InLoopBack0                     Flags        : D                
                                                                                    
     Destination  : FC00::                          PrefixLength : 64               
     NextHop      : FC00::1                         Preference   : 0                
     Cost         : 0                               Protocol     : Direct           
     RelayNextHop : ::                              TunnelID     : 0x0              
     Interface    : GigabitEthernet0/0/1            Flags        : D                
                                                                                    
     Destination  : FC00::1                         PrefixLength : 128              
     NextHop      : ::1                             Preference   : 0                
     Cost         : 0                               Protocol     : Direct           
     RelayNextHop : ::                              TunnelID     : 0x0              
     Interface    : GigabitEthernet0/0/1            Flags        : D                
                                                                                    
     Destination  : FE80::                          PrefixLength : 10               
     NextHop      : ::                              Preference   : 0                
     Cost         : 0                               Protocol     : Direct           
     RelayNextHop : ::                              TunnelID     : 0x0              
     Interface    : NULL0                           Flags        : D                

    # 对SwitchB的接口GE0/0/1执行shutdown命令模拟链路故障。

    [SwitchB] interface GigabitEthernet 0/0/1
    [SwitchB-GigabitEthernet0/0/1] shutdown

    # 查看SwitchA的路由表,发现静态缺省路由0::0/0也不存在了。因为静态缺省路由绑定了BFD会话,当BFD检测到故障后,就会迅速通知所绑定的静态路由不可用。

    [SwitchA] display ipv6 routing-table
    Routing Table : Public                                                          
            Destinations : 1        Routes : 1                                      
                                                                                    
     Destination  : ::1                             PrefixLength : 128              
     NextHop      : ::1                             Preference   : 0                
     Cost         : 0                               Protocol     : Direct           
     RelayNextHop : ::                              TunnelID     : 0x0              
     Interface    : InLoopBack0                     Flags        : D                

配置文件

  • SwitchA的配置文件

    #
    sysname SwitchA
    #
    ipv6
    #
    bfd
    #
    interface GigabitEthernet0/0/1
     undo portswitch
     ipv6 enable
     ipv6 address FC00::1/64
    #
    bfd aa bind peer-ipv6 FC00::2
     discriminator local 10
     discriminator remote 20
     commit
    #
    ipv6 route-static :: 0 FC00::2 track bfd-session aa
    #
    return
  • SwitchB的配置文件

    #
    sysname SwitchB
    #
    ipv6
    #
    bfd
    #
    interface GigabitEthernet0/0/1
     undo portswitch
     ipv6 enable
     ipv6 address FC00::2/64
    #
    bfd bb bind peer-ipv6 FC00::1
     discriminator local 20
     discriminator remote 10
     commit
    #
    return
翻译
下载文档
更新时间:2019-04-17

文档编号:EDOC1000141402

浏览量:22995

下载量:1351

平均得分:
本文档适用于这些产品
相关文档
相关版本
分享
上一页 下一页